It took six innings from Max Scherzer, four relievers in the seventh, and five outs from Sean Doolittle, but the Nationals beat the Marlins in last night’s series opener in Miami. So about that bullpen usage?
“At that point I told [pitching coach Derek Lilliquist], “All hands on deck,’” Davey Martinez explained when asked about how handled things once Scherzer was done.
“We’ve got to keep the game where we’re at and get a win out of it. And the boys in the bullpen did great.”
Sammy Solis tied Rockies’ reliever Bryan Shaw with his 27th appearance in 49 games when he took the mound last night...
